As the utility of genetic testing in pediatric neurology is expanding, so are the testing options. It can be challenging to determine which test is the most appropriate. Clinicians can order genetic tests that assess a single gene, a small panel of genes, or the entire genome. Further adding to the complexity, each test uses different methodologies, each of which can detect only certain types of variants. Identifying which test is right for a specific situation involves collaborating with patients, families, and genetic experts to evaluate the potential value of a molecular diagnosis, the benefits and limitations of genetic testing, and relevant factors in genomic test selection.
This module will provide an overview of the issues clinicians should consider when deciding whether to offer neurogenetic testing and choosing among the available tests.

Genetic testing in pediatric neurology can provide valuable information for diagnosis and treatment. Genetic tests with a larger scope, including exome testing, have benefits and limitations which include:
- Greater potential yield for identifying a causative variant.
- Increased likelihood of identifying uncertain or secondary findings.
- Lower sensitivity for certain types of variants, including deletions/duplications and trinucleotide repeats.
Other considerations for genetic testing
- Genetic test methodologies differ in the types of variants they can detect.
- Thoughtful test selection is required because of the variability in what labs offer, including the ability to detect a specific condition.
- There are options for people who have had inconclusive genomic testing previously because testing evolves.
- Collaborating with a genetic expert is important due to the complexity of genetic testing.
- Facilitating shared decision-making with the family helps determine the test characteristics that best fit the family's needs and perspectives.
